Karnataka will scrap the National Education Policy 2020 (NEP) from the next academic year, chief minister Siddaramaiah said. Addressing state Congress committee members, the CM said: “NEP must be abolished after the necessary preparations, which could not be done on time this year. By the time the poll results were out and the new government was formed, the academic year had already started.” Making changes in the middle of the academic session would have created problems, he added. Siddaramaiah accused BJP of harming the interest of students by implementing NEP in Karnataka before other states could do so. Academics had mixed reactions to the announcement.
